Paula Walsh
Director
Paula leads Arup’s business in London and the South-East of England, and is a member of the UK, India, Middle East and Africa Region board.
She has more than 30 years’ experience in the property industry, working with local, national and international clients to maximise the potential of their projects for the benefit of owners, investors, users and the wider community.
Throughout her career, she has led the planning and design of a variety of complex projects working across a range of sectors, including commercial, residential and more recently station development. She enjoys working with clients, architects and other collaborators to redefine expectations of quality living and working environments, helping to generate new pieces of city by pushing the boundaries on innovation, social value, sustainability and inclusivity.
Much of her work has focused on major developments in London, including the More London development, 52 Lime Street, the Ebury Bridge Estate regeneration, the redevelopment of Kings Cross and more recently Euston. As a diverse place of creativity, open to new arrivals and new ideas, she is passionate about building on London’s rich history to shape its next stage of development.
